Professional Activities

Faculty and students attend one or more professional conferences each year. In the fall, faculty travel to either the New England Psychological Association Conference, or the Berkshire Association of Behavior Analysis and Therapy Conference. Often in the spring, faculty and a few students attend the Mainely Data conference, a Maine based meeting of faculty and students presenting and discussing their recent psychological research.  Students are encouraged to collaborate with a faculty member to conduct research and present data at one or more of these forums. Often, students complete research for credit by enrolling in Advanced Research (PSY 480), where they design and execute a research protocol with faculty guidance.
